Blade Runner: First Home Video Graded by CGC Offered at Auction for a Second Time

CGC's first VHS graded — Blade Runner — has re-emerged in the market in Heritage Auctions’ latest home video collectibles sale. It is among the CGC-certified VHS and Betamax tapes available in Heritage’s VHS and Home Entertainment Showcase Auction, which is set to end on March 28, 2025.
The sealed Blade Runner VHS, Embassy Home Entertainment (1983) graded CGC 9.0 A++ and pedigreed as the First VHS Graded by CGC Home Video (lot 4010) is available for bidding for only the second time since it first appeared in auction in June 2023, where it realized $5,750. Since its original release in 1982, Blade Runner has become a cult classic, with many of its themes and settings serving as inspiration for modern science fiction films.

Additionally, a sealed First Blood VHS, Thorn EMI Video (1982) graded CGC 9.4 B+ (lot 4022) is turning heads in the sale. This is a first release copy, which is exceptionally more rare than later releases of the film on VHS. The film stars Sylvester Stallone as John Rambo, a former Vietnam veteran who confronts a small town’s police force in a violent confrontation after he and others are mistreated. First Blood established Stallone’s stardom and launched the Rambo franchise.

Other CGC-certified home video collectibles in the auction include:
- a sealed Blade Runner Betamax, Embassy Home Entertainment (1983) graded CGC 8.0 A (lot 4011)
- a sealed Star Wars: The Empire Strikes Back VHS, CBS / Fox Video (1984) graded CGC 8.5 A+ (lot 4071)
- a sealed Star Wars: Return of the Jedi VHS, CBS / Fox Video (1986) graded CGC 9.4 A (lot 4072)
- a sealed Die Hard VHS, CBS / Fox Video (1989) graded CGC 7.5 B+ (lot 4018)
- a sealed Barbella: Queen of the Galaxy Betamax, Paramount Home Video (1979) graded CGC 7.5 A and pedigreed to The Audio / Video Plus Collection (lot 4008)
- a sealed Raging Bull VHS, CBS / Fox Video (1984) graded CGC 9.0 B+ (lot 4057)
About CGC
Since revolutionizing comic book grading in 2000, CGC has grown to include certification services for a vast variety of pop culture collectibles. These divisions include CGC Cards, CGC Video Games and CGC Home Video. CGC Cards provides expert card grading for sports cards, TCGs and non-sports cards. CGC Video Games is dedicated to video game grading for the most popular consoles, including Nintendo, Sega, Atari, PlayStation and more. CGC Home Video provides expert VHS grading in addition to other types of videocassettes, DVD, Blu-ray and more. CGC also offers seamless solutions for autograph collectors with CGC Signature Series and JSA Authentic Autograph services.
